The Confession The Confession
2017
The White Devil The White Devil
2016
The Lizard The Lizard
2025
The Big Boom The Big Boom
2007
The Ancient Rain The Ancient Rain
2013
Naked Moon Naked Moon
2010
Chasing the Dragon: A North Beach Mystery (Unabridged) Chasing the Dragon: A North Beach Mystery (Unabridged)
2010
The Ancient Rain: A North Beach Mystery (Unabridged) The Ancient Rain: A North Beach Mystery (Unabridged)
2010
The Big Boom: A North Beach Mystery (Unabridged) The Big Boom: A North Beach Mystery (Unabridged)
2010
Naked Moon: A North Beach Mystery (Unabridged) Naked Moon: A North Beach Mystery (Unabridged)
2010
The Confession (Unabridged) The Confession (Unabridged)
2010